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and device for implementing identity-based electronic signature

A technology of electronic signature and implementation method, which is applied in the direction of user identity/authority verification, etc., can solve problems such as too long signature information, and achieve the effect of increasing throughput

Active Publication Date: 2018-05-01
AEROSPACE INFORMATION
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0015] The disadvantage of the schemes in Document 1 and Document 2 above is that the signature information is too long. For example, the length of the signature information in Document 1 is 4n, and the length of the signature information in Document 2 is 2n, where n is a finite field F p The bit length of , so in the context of resource constraints, the use of the above-mentioned schemes of Document 1 and Document 2 is subject to great limitations

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for implementing identity-based electronic signature
  • Method and device for implementing identity-based electronic signature

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0062] This embodiment provides a processing flow of an implementation method of an identity-based electronic signature as follows: figure 1 As shown, the following processing steps are included:

[0063] Step S110, generating and issuing system parameters.

[0064] Choose a safe elliptic curve. Define a finite field F p Equation of the upper elliptic curve E: y 2 =x 3 +ax+b, where p is a large prime number, the order of curve E #E(F p )=cf*q, where cf is the cofactor and q is the generator P 1 order, q>2 191 , is a large prime number, the curve E(F p ) is k embedding times relative to q, requiring p k >2 1536 , choose a secure hash function H 1 and H 2 .

[0065] G 1 and G 2 for E(F p ) on the cyclic addition group of order q, for the cyclic addition group G of order q 1 and G 2 , and the cyclic multiplicative group G T , defining a bilinear map ê:G 1 ×G 2 →G T . where P 1 is G 1 Generator of P 2 is G 2 generator of .

[0066] h 1 : {0,1} * →G 1 ...

Embodiment 2

[0117] This embodiment provides an identity-based electronic signature implementation device 200, and its specific implementation structure is as follows figure 2 As shown, it can specifically include the following modules:

[0118] The system parameter generating module 210 is used to select a safe elliptic curve and define a finite field F p Equation of the upper elliptic curve E: y 2 =x 3 +ax+b, where a, b are set parameters, p, q are set large prime numbers, the order of curve E #E(F p )=cf*q, where cf is the cofactor and q is the generator P 1 order, q>2 191 , curve E(F p ) is k embedding times relative to q, requiring p k>2 1536 , for the cyclic addition group G of order q 1 and G 2 , and the cyclic multiplicative group G T , defining a bilinear map ê:G 1 ×G 2 →G T , where P 1 is G 1 Generator of P 2 is G 2 generator of

[0119] h 1 : {0,1} * →G 1 , is a one-way hash function that maps a string of arbitrary length 0, 1 to G 1 a point on the ellipti...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the present invention provides a method and device for implementing an identity-based electronic signature. The method mainly includes four steps: generating system public parameters; generating a user's public-private key pair; using the signer's private key to electronically sign the message message; according to the system public parameters and the signer's public key Check the signature of the message message. The device mainly includes: a system parameter generation module, a user private key generation module, a signature module and a seal verification module. The length of the digital signature of the electronic document in the embodiment of the present invention is only the abscissa of the elliptic curve point, which is shorter than the length of the signature message based on the existing identity signature method, which increases the throughput of the system operation and is suitable for applications with limited bandwidth. communication environment, thereby effectively applying identity-based cryptographic technology to electronic signatures.

Description

technical field [0001] The invention relates to the technical field of electronic signatures, in particular to a method and device for realizing an identity-based electronic signature. Background technique [0002] With the widespread use of public key technology, digital signature technology has become an important guarantee for the authenticity, integrity and non-repudiation of network data transmission. In the traditional paper-based office process, the content of the document is confirmed or reviewed by signing and stamping. Bind the image of the signature or seal with the user's private key to form an electronic seal, and use the electronic seal to perform digital signature operations on electronic documents, so as to realize the effective fusion of the signature or seal image and the digital signature. [0003] In 1984, Shamir proposed a new cryptosystem—identity-based public key cryptosystem, whose main feature is that under this cryptosystem, the public key can be a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L9/32
Inventor 张庆胜郭宝安徐树民孟小虎罗世新苏斌王永宝
Owner AEROSPACE INFORMATION